About Rio Rancho, NM

As a Travel Labor and Delivery Nurse in Rio Rancho, NM here's what you should know:
Cost of Living
  • Lower than the national average, making it an affordable option for travel nurses.
  • Wages generally match the lower cost of living.
Weather
  • Summer average highs of 90°F and lows of 60°F.
  • Winter average highs of 50°F and lows of 20°F.
Furnished Housing
  • Short term rentals are available and relatively easy to find, with options ranging from apartments to single-family homes.
Transportation
  • Car friendliness is high, and public transportation options are limited.
Demographics
  • Diverse community with a mix of age ranges.
  • Common health issues include allergies and respiratory conditions.
  • Rio Rancho has a growing population of travel nurses.
Things to Do
  • Plenty of restaurants offering a variety of cuisines, local art galleries, music venues, and outdoor activities such as hiking and biking.
